Biosynthesis of Nanoparticles from Halophiles,philic organisms is in its infancy and has only been reported in few organisms. This chapter aims to shed light on the various halophilic organisms and their by-products that have been exploited for nanomaterial synthesis, the mechanisms that may be involved in the nanomaterial fabrication and the p

Halophilic Microorganisms and Their Biomolecules: Approaching into Frame of Bio(Nano) Technologies,ganisms, i.e. enzymes, halocins (halobacterial proteins with antibiotic activities), exopolysaccharides showed biological activity in harsh conditions. Combination of these bio-molecules with various nanomaterials like thin-layers, nanotubes, nanospheres results in novel compounds possessing both bi

Microbial Hydrocarbon-Removal Under Halostress, with other microbes to form biofilms on animate and inanimates substrates. Seawaters accommodate numerous hydrocarbonoclastic bacteria belonging predominantly to the Gammaproteobacteria subgroup.
